- Rated 1 out of 5by Firefox user 15728422, 5 years agoWith the most recent update sometime in 2020, this add-on is now broken. It no longer blocks video ads on YouTube, it doesn't block ads on some sites and you can no longer block ads by selection. I don't know what the developers were thinking by updating to this broken version, but they need to rethink that change. 1 star.
Developer response
posted 5 years agoHi, We believe this is an issue related to being unsubscribed to our primary filter list, EasyList. To enable EasyList, please click the AdBlock button in the browser toolbar and select Options. On the Filter lists tab, select "EasyList". Refresh the page where you were seeing ads.
